Doing Good Without Seeing the Results

And let us not be weary in well doing: for in due season we shall reap, if we faint not.

Galatians 6:9

One of the hardest things to sustain is consistency when there's no visible result. You did the right thing, and no one noticed. You chose good, and it seems like nothing changed. You're trying, working hard, seeking — and the harvest is slow to come.

Paul says: don't grow weary. In due time, it will come.

There's a difference between doing good to be seen and doing good because it's what God calls you to do. The second one sustains you far longer — because it doesn't depend on the world's applause to keep standing.

Your faithfulness in the small things, in the invisible choices, in the care you show people when no one's watching — that carries eternal weight. God sees it. And the seed you plant today, even if you don't see it grow, will bear fruit.

Don't lose heart. Don't stop doing good. God's timing isn't yours — but it comes.
